Transaction 3daf109e8adc5589ed54ed8b64c219772cd6dbefb92372f7f146fad63eb03b72
1 Input
2 Outputs
- 3daf109e8adc5589ed54ed8b64c219772cd6dbefb92372f7f146fad63eb03b72:0
- 3daf109e8adc5589ed54ed8b64c219772cd6dbefb92372f7f146fad63eb03b72:1
value 327308
address 32uPLTmWJi5u4dCHdrSAhSp36its42erNn
value 1154465
address 1J8DSsgwk49g17DCwEoQStHeJWXJac2h2e